Booked to play their first ever Hong Kong show on July 10 at MOM Live House, Anglo-Antipodean quartet Splashh are often portrayed as lo-fi at heart, wearing a veneer of summery aspiration. Their brand of indie conservatism was perfected just this April with the release of Waiting a Lifetime, something of a masterclass in bittersweet indie melancholy. It's a formula that makes for a band that's instantly accessible, intuitive and fun to listen to, while hiding a satisfying dourness if you scratch beneath the surface.
